Important settings for your list:
Subscription= By_Owner Subscribers must be added by the list
owner
Send= Private Only list subscribers may post to this
list.
Reply-To= Sender,Ignore Listserv will set Reply-To tag in
messages from the list to original
poster, and ignore any such tag set by
poster.
Confidential= Yes The list will not be published on
public lists-of-lists.

Listserv basics for listowners and subscribers:
> Listserv commands via email, such as subscription management requests,
are sent to the *server* address,
listserv@listserv.uga.edu
> Posting to the list:
To send mail to the list (ie, to all list subscribers), send
the message to the *list* address,
LISTNAME@listserv.uga.edu .
See the settings above for who is authorized to post to this list.
---------------------------------------------------------------------
Basic Listserv commands for listowners:
> NEW: check out managing your list on the web at
www.listserv.uga.edu
You will need to get a listserv password (good for any lists
you manage or are subscribed to on UGA's server). Then go
to the Manage page, where you can perform all the functions
described below very quickly and easily.
> List owners are not automatically subscribed to their list.
They must subscribe (or be added) in order to receive list postings.
> to add someone to the list, send the Listserv command:
add listname userid@node
